As the subject of an experiment for treating cigarette addiction, john is being given a chemical agent that makes him feel nause
lara31 [8.8K]
Based on the description, <span>this experiment is most likely an </span>aversive conditioning Experiment.
Aversive conditioning experiment is created to associate a substance/behavior that wanted to be eliminated with some negative stimuli (such as pain or nausea). This will train the brain to reject the existence of that substance/behavior in our body.
